Meaning & Symbolism
The name Esme is derived from the Old French verb 'esmer,' meaning 'to estimate' or 'to esteem,' which itself comes from the Latin 'aestimare.' Therefore, the name literally means 'esteemed' or 'loved.' This etymology imbues the name with a delicate, cherished connotation, suggesting someone held in high regard or deeply affectionate.

History & Popularity
Esme has a fascinating history, notably linked to Scottish nobility through Esmé Stewart, 1st Duke of Lennox, a male figure in the 16th century. Over time, it gained prominence as a feminine name, particularly in the 20th century. Its popularity received a significant boost in both the UK and US, especially following its prominent inclusion in Stephenie Meyer's 'Twilight' series (Esme Cullen). In the UK, it has been a consistently popular choice, often ranking within the top 100 girls' names. In the US, while not reaching the top tier, it experienced a surge after 'Twilight' and maintains a steady presence, perceived as a stylish, somewhat ethereal, and sophisticated option, balancing classic charm with modern appeal.
